The impact of indoor pollution, dust allergy, obesity, sinus blockage, stress, and long exposure to the air conditioner gradually takes a toll on the quality of breathing without being noticed. Therefore, sleep loss, dry mouth, chest constriction, and breathing difficulties are common symptoms of the night today for younger adults.

People often blame acidity, fatigue, or weather changes for disturbed breathing at night today. However, untreated respiratory irritation gradually affects oxygen flow, sleep quality, and concentration during the day when proper pulmonary assessment is still delayed regularly.
